What is an Enterprise Internet browser and Why Does It Matter?
An venture web browser functions as a regulated atmosphere for staff members to securely access company sources. Unlike conventional web browsers, it integrates enterprise-grade safety procedures such as zero-trust gain access to controls, advanced data loss avoidance (DLP), and centralized plan enforcement.
SURF Safety and security takes this principle further by providing a Chromium-based web browser that ensures experience for end-users while installing robust safety methods. The browser becomes a fortified access factor, securing organizations from online susceptabilities and securing sensitive data.
